Ingredients & Why They Work
-
1 box fudge brownie mix (19.5 oz) – This is the base of the cookie. It gives that signature brownie flavor and chewy texture.
-
2 teaspoons vanilla extract – Enhances flavor and brings warmth to the chocolate base.
-
1 teaspoon cornstarch – Adds structure to the dough and keeps cookies from spreading too much.
-
¼ cup butter, melted – Provides fat for richness and chewiness.
-
4 oz cream cheese, softened – Adds moisture, soft texture, and a subtle tang to balance the sweetness.
-
1 egg – Binds the ingredients together and gives the cookies lift.
For the peanut butter filling:
-
1 cup powdered sugar – Sweetens and firms up the peanut butter mixture.
-
1 cup creamy peanut butter – The heart of the buckeye flavor; smooth, rich, and perfectly spreadable.
For the topping:
-
4 oz semi-sweet chocolate chips – Melted over the peanut butter centers for that buckeye candy finish.
How to Make Buckeye Brownie Cookies
-
Preheat & Prep
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ment or use an ungreased cookie sheet. -
Make the Cookie Dough
In a medium bowl, combine:-
Brownie mix
-
Vanilla extract
-
Cornstarch
-
Melted butter
-
Softened cream cheese
-
Egg
Mix with a hand mixer until a sticky dough forms.
-
-
Scoop & Shape
Scoop out heaping tablespoons of dough and gently smooth into round cookie shapes. These cookies won’t spread much, so form them close to the final shape. -
Bake
Bake for 12 minutes until the cookies are set but still soft in the center. -
Make Peanut Butter Balls
While cookies bake, stir together powdered sugar and peanut butter until smooth. Roll into 1-inch balls, one for each cookie. -
Add Buckeye Centers
Once cookies are out of the oven, immediately press a peanut butter ball into the center of each cookie. Let cool on the tray for 5 minutes, then transfer to a wire rack. -
Melt the Chocolate
In a microwave-safe bowl, heat chocolate chips in 30-second intervals, stirring until smooth and glossy. -
Top the Cookies
Spoon about ½ tablespoon of melted chocolate over the peanut butter balls, leaving the edges visible like a traditional buckeye. -
Cool & Store
Let the chocolate set completely. Store c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 5 days (or refrigerate to keep them firm).

Pro Tips for Perfect Buckeye Cookies
-
Use room temperature cream cheese to avoid lumps in your dough.
-
Don’t overbake—they’ll continue to set as they cool.
-
Chill the peanut butter balls for 10 minutes before pressing into cookies to help them hold shape.
-
For cleaner chocolate tops, use a piping bag or spoon chocolate from a zip-top bag with the corner snipped.

Storing & Freezing
-
Store: In an airtight container at room temp for up to 5 days.
-
Freeze: Flash freeze on a tray, then store in a zip-top freezer bag for up to 2 months. Thaw at room temperature before serving.
